6. UNFINISHED BUSINESS
6.1 2016 Annual General Adjustment and Adoption of Banking of
Unimplemented Annual General Adjustments Regulations (Chapter 7)
Justin Bigelow, Special Counsel, Goldfarb and Lipman, presented an oral report and
responded to questions.

MOTION: M/S - Grunewald/ Means - To instruct staff to draft an expedited petition
process to address inflation that occurred prior to 9/1/2016 (2.6%) for units that were
continuously owned by the same Landlord, occupied by the same tenant, and were
not subject to a rent increase between October 19, 2015 and December 23, 2016
OR
to re-consider the draft 2016 annual general adjustment resolution presented to the
RHC with the requirement that the 2016 AGA would apply to units that were not
subject to a rent increase between October 19, 2015 and December 23, 2016.
Yes: 3- Committee Member Grunewald, Committee Member Ramos, and Committee
Member Means
No: 1- Vice Chair Ortiz
Abstain: 1- Chairperson Honey
MOTION: M/S - Means/ Honey - To adopt regulations regarding the Banking of
Unimplemented Annual General Adjustments with direction to staff to bring back options
for tenant hardship protections.
Yes: 5- Vice Chair Ortiz, Chairperson Honey, Committee Member Grunewald, Committee
Member Ramos, and Committee Member Means
